A virtual data room (VDR) is a secure, cloud-based platform that provides a collaborative space for companies to share their data. VDRs are most commonly used for high-risk business activities like mergers and acquisitions, due diligence and fundraising. They provide a secure and safe environment where users can look over and comment on confidential documents, as well as electronically sign legally binding electronic signatures.
Most well-known data rooms come with additional security features, such as the ability to track downloads, disable screen shots, and limit permissions for users. These advanced features can improve the security of your data room, and also prevent sensitive information from falling into the wrong hands.
A VDR in addition to improving the security of your data room online, could also boost the efficiency of your team by making it possible to collaborate and share important files electronically. By eliminating the need for physical meetings, you can save money on travel costs and reduce office space. Additionally, by storing your information digitally you are less prone to the risk of losing important documents in the event of a workplace fire or natural catastrophe.
